搞基软件,不这么做!

来源:证券时报网作者:
字号

网络通信

场景:一家公司需要开发一个高效的网络通信协议,以提高数据传输速度和安全性。

选择“搞基软件”:开发自己的网络协议栈,可以实现最高的性能和安全控制。这需要深厚的网络技术知识和大量的开发时间。

选择同类软件:使用现有的网络通信工具和协议,如TCP/IP协议、SSL/TLS等,这些工具和协议经过广泛验证和优化,能够提供高效、安全的通信功能。

3API接口改进

简化API设计:通过简化API设计,减少复杂度,使其更加易于使用。例如,将多个复杂的API合并为一个简单的API,提高用户的使用体验。

增加文档和示例:提供详细的API文档和使用示例,帮助用户更快速地上手。定期更新文档,以反映最新的API变化。

响应时间优化:通过对服务器端代码进行优化,减少API响应时间。例如,使用异步处理和分布式缓存,提高响应速度。

为什么“搞基软件”如此重要?

稳定性和可靠性:基础软件确保计算机系统的稳定性和可靠性。高质量的操作系统和驱动程序可以避免系统崩💡溃和数据丢失,为用户提供一个安全的计算环境。

兼容性:基础软件确保不🎯同的硬件设备和应用程序之间的兼容性。这意味着用户可以在同一个系统中使用各种不同的软件和设备,而不需要担心它们是否能够协调工作。

资源管理:基础软件管理计算机的资源,如CPU、内存和存储设备。它优化资源的分配和使用,使计算机能够高效运行多任务。

安全性:现代基础软件包含了许多安全机制,如防火墙、加密和身份验证,确保系统免受各种网络攻击和恶意软件。

不要忽视持续学习

技术发展日新月异,在搞基软件的过程中,必须保持持续学习的态度。关注最新的技术趋势和开发工具,参加行业会议和培训,阅读相关书籍和文章,都是提升技术水平的重要途径。持续学习不仅能帮助你掌握最新的技术,还能开阔视野,激发创新思维。

在搞基软件的过程中,除了以上提到的关键要点外,还有一些常见的错误和误区,需要特别注意。避免这些错误和误区,才能真正做到“搞基软件,不这么做!”

未来展望

在未来的开发中,我们将继续关注用户反馈,持续优化软件连接功能。具体计划如下:

持续优化数据库查询:进一步研究和应用更高级的数据库优化技术,如分布式数据库和大数据处理技术。

提升网络通信性能:探索更多先进的网络通信技术,如QUIC等,进一步😎提升数据传输的速度和稳定性。

不断改进API设计:根据用户需求和反馈,持续改进API设计,确保其简洁易用,并提供更全面的文档和示例。

通过以上措施,我们相信基础软件的连接功能将会进一步😎提升,为用户提供更加稳定、高效和友好的使用体验。

物联网(IoT)的基础

物联网(InternetofThings)是当今科技的重要发展方向之一。从智能家居设备到工业控制系统,物联网设备的运行都依赖于基础软件。这些软件负责设备间的通信、数据处理和分析,确保物联网系统的高效运作。基础软件在物联网中的应用,使得设备能够实时地传输数据,并根据数据进行智能化决策。

基础软件的定义及其重要性

基础软件(BaseSoftware)是指支撑其他应用程序运行的系统软件,如操作系统、数据库管理系统等。它们在各种计算环境中提供基础服务,包括文件系统管理、内存管理、进程控制和设备接口等。基础软件的跨平台连接问题直接关系到其他应用程序的稳定性和高效运行。

什么是搞基软件?

搞基软件(基础设施软件)是指在其他应用软件之上运行的系统软件。它提供了一个稳定、可靠的运行环境,使得各种应用程序能够正常工作。搞基软件通常📝包括操作系统(如Windows、Linux)、数据库管理系统(如MySQL、Oracle)、网络服务器(如Apache、Nginx)等。

校对:何伟(6cEOas9M38Kzgk9u8uBurka8zPFcs4sd)

责任编辑: 李瑞英
为你推荐
用户评论
登录后可以发言
网友评论仅供其表达个人看法,并不表明证券时报立场
暂无评论